What the Science Says: Physical Activity and the Brain
The scientific community has been building a compelling case for years. A landmark systematic review and meta-analysis published in Frontiers in Public Health found that researching the relationship between physical activity and academic performance is becoming an important research topic due to increasing evidence about the positive effect of physical activity on cognitive functioning.
The mechanisms behind this connection are physiological and measurable. Engaging in activities that get the heart pumping increases blood flow to the brain, delivering a surge of oxygen and nutrients — a boost in nourishment that enhances neural connections, fostering improved focus and attention spans. At the neurochemical level, physical activities release chemicals such as endorphins and dopamine, which enhance mood and focus — chemicals that not only help students stay attentive but also reduce stress, allowing them to approach academic challenges with a calm and focused mind.
Even more striking is what happens at a structural level inside the developing brain. A study from Boston Children's Hospital, which analyzed brain imaging data from nearly 6,000 9- and 10-year-olds, found that physical activity was associated with more efficiently organized, robust, and flexible brain networks. Perhaps most encouraging for parents was the finding that the more physical activity, the more 'fit' the brain — and it didn't matter what kind of physical activity children were involved in, only that they were active.
Further research has confirmed that low levels of physical activity are associated with a decline in academic performance, possibly due to the deterioration of brain structure and thus cognitive abilities and brain function. In other words, inactivity isn't neutral — it carries real costs for a child's learning potential.
Key Academic and Cognitive Benefits of Regular Exercise
Improved Focus and Attention
One of the most consistent findings across the research is the impact of physical activity on a child's ability to concentrate. The ability to focus attention is improved among children who participate in physical activities. For children sitting in classrooms for hours each day, this is no small advantage.
Physical activity increases oxygen flow to the brain, enhancing problem-solving abilities and concentration, and children who engage in sports experience less mental fatigue, making them more attentive during school hours. A telling example: one study showed that children walking 20 minutes at a moderate pace on a treadmill were able to respond better to spelling, reading, and math questions compared to students who remained sitting.
Better Memory and Information Retention
Exercise also plays a significant role in how well children retain and recall what they learn. A study by the University of British Columbia found that aerobic exercise has the unique ability to increase the size of the hippocampus — the area of the brain responsible for learning and memory — which is one reason why students who play sports tend to perform better on tests and retain information more effectively.
Exercise helps to increase the hippocampus and the basal ganglia, both structures of the brain which are involved with learning in children. These structural changes are not temporary — they reflect genuine growth in brain regions that children rely on every single school day.
Stronger Executive Function
Executive function is the set of mental skills that includes working memory, flexible thinking, and self-control. These abilities underpin a child's capacity to follow instructions, manage time, plan ahead, and stay organised — all essential for academic success.
Research has found that acute physical activity interventions significantly improved processing speed, inhibition, and attention, whereas chronic physical activity interventions significantly improved processing speed, attention, cognitive flexibility, working memory, and language skills. Sport in particular seems to be especially effective here. Research identified superior cognitive performance of soccer players over non-athletes in executive control, attention, working memory, vigilance, and cognitive flexibility.
Learning-related mechanisms focus on the cognitive demand that exists during the learning of motor skills and the coordination of complex movements, enhancing decision-making processes and flexible behaviour in response to demands. In other words, the mental effort required to learn a new sport skill is itself a form of cognitive training.
Reduced Stress and Better Emotional Regulation
Academic pressure is a very real experience for many children in Singapore. Physical activity offers a powerful, natural buffer. Inhibitory control — the ability to stop or modify an impulse — and selective attention are both shown to increase with exercise, while aggression and anxiety decrease and self-confidence and adaptability skills flourish.
Exercise also leads to short-term relaxation, which improves kids' moods as well as promoting increased concentration, better memory, enhanced creativity, and more effective problem-solving. When children are emotionally regulated and less anxious, they are far better positioned to engage with challenging schoolwork and bounce back from setbacks.
How Much Physical Activity Do Children Actually Need?
Understanding the benefits is one thing — knowing what to aim for is another. According to the World Health Organization, children and adolescents should do at least an average of 60 minutes per day of moderate- to vigorous-intensity, mostly aerobic, physical activity across the week. For younger children, the bar is even higher: the WHO recommends that preschool-aged children engage in 180 minutes of total physical activity including 60 minutes of moderate-to-vigorous physical activity each day.
The type of activity matters too. In children and adolescents, physical activity confers benefits for cognitive outcomes including academic performance and executive function, particularly when activity is consistent, appropriately intense, and varied. Research also highlights that interventions involving exercise of greater intensity and length as well as gross motor skills led to more pronounced improvements in academic performance.
Critically, studies found that physical activity interventions with significant positive effects on academic performance were more likely to be delivered by practitioners who held higher qualifications in physical education and exercise science, with those interventions producing higher population effects. This underscores the importance not just of activity, but of quality, structured programming delivered by knowledgeable coaches.
Sports as a Classroom: Building Character That Drives Academic Success
The cognitive benefits of physical activity are only part of the story. Organised sports provide a unique environment for character development — and the qualities children build on the field translate directly into academic habits and life skills.
Discipline and time management are two of the most valuable outcomes. Participating in sports requires commitment and discipline. Children learn to balance practices, games, homework, and family time — a necessity for organisation that helps them develop time management skills invaluable as they grow older.
Resilience is another cornerstone. Participating in sports teaches children resilience and how to cope with stress. In team sports, children learn how to handle both wins and losses gracefully — life lessons that help them navigate stressful academic situations with confidence and perseverance.
Teamwork and communication skills developed through sport also carry over into academic contexts. Team sports require communication, both verbal and nonverbal, and those same communication skills developed to maintain a functioning team can help kids succeed academically.
A recent study from the Netherlands found that children who play team sports tend to have better executive function, which includes things like memory, focus, ability to adapt, and emotional control. These are precisely the qualities that help children manage the demands of school life with confidence.

Tips for Parents: Supporting an Active Learning Lifestyle
For parents looking to maximise the academic and developmental benefits of physical activity, here are some practical steps:
Aim for 60 minutes of daily movement. This doesn't need to happen in one block. School PE, active play, and after-school programmes all count toward the daily target.
Prioritise variety and enjoyment. Children who enjoy their physical activity are more likely to stay consistent. Exploring different sports helps them discover what they love while developing a broad range of movement skills.
Choose quality programmes with qualified coaches. As research shows, the expertise of those delivering physical activity shapes its impact. Look for programmes with structured curricula designed for your child's specific age and developmental stage.
Balance active time with adequate rest. Sports boost memory function and cognitive function, in part because physical exercise improves the quality and duration of sleep — so ensuring your child winds down properly after activity is equally important.
Connect activity to values, not just outcomes. Let your child know that being active is about growing as a person — building courage, kindness, and persistence — not just getting fit or winning.
Limit excessive screen time. Excessive use of electronic devices by children may result in negative outcomes regarding physical health, behaviour, and intellectual skills including language, concentration, and memory. Active play is one of the best replacements.
